Step four: Work the face and mouth muscles. That is the place for tongue twisters. Many vocal coaches can have you sing a tongue-torquing phrase whereas having you go up and down the scale. However start first in a spread thats comfy for you. When using these phrases, make sure youre enunciating clearly-even overenunciating; the purpose is to give your face and tongue a exercise-and that youre supporting your singing with good breath control. Focusing on your consonants and vowels is one other good idea. Remember, singing solely takes place on a vowel; the consonant sound is pitchless. That means your vowels all must be exquisitely shaped in your mouth to give the suitable sound, and your consonants needs to be crisp and brief.
